New AI Feature Boosts Google Workspace Productivity

Google has rolled out a handy new feature for its Workspace Studio, which is where people can build custom programs to automate tasks. Essentially, it allows these programs to loop through lists of items — think through a list of customer names, inventory items, or project tasks. While it sounds a bit technical, it means that the AI tools you build in Workspace can now handle repetitive jobs much more efficiently. It’s like teaching a digital assistant to go through a checklist item by item, without needing to be told what to do each time.

For a small business owner, this could be a real game-changer. Imagine regularly sending out personalised emails to a list of clients, updating multiple records in a spreadsheet, or processing a batch of invoices. Previously, setting up an AI to do this might have been more complex or required multiple steps. Now, with the ability to 'loop', the AI can simply work through your list automatically, handling each item one after the other until the whole job is done.

This update builds on Google's existing AI assistant, Gemini, which is integrated into Workspace. It means that tasks which used to take human effort or tricky coding can now be streamlined. For example, if you have a list of enquiries and want Gemini to draft a response for each, it can now do so in one go, rather than you having to manually input each enquiry. This frees up staff for more important, strategic work that truly needs a human touch.

In essence, Google is making its AI tools more powerful and flexible, aiming to reduce the kind of tedious, repetitive tasks that eat into a workday. While it's primarily targeted at those already using or building automations in Workspace, it signifies a broader trend: AI is getting better at handling routine administrative work. This means fewer hours spent on mundane tasks and more time for growing your business or focusing on what really matters.

Why it matters

This update helps small businesses and workers save precious time by letting AI handle routine, repetitive tasks. It means less time spent on mundane administrative work and more time for problem-solving, customer service, or growing your business.
